Vintage WW11 Era Pennant of HMCS ONTARIO

Vintage WW11 Era Pennant of HMCS ONTARIO
Launched in the UK in July 1943 and named HMS Minotaur but transferred to the Royal Canadian Navy and named HMCS Ontario upon completion. Was rammed by a chilean merchant vessel on the Rio del Plata as she was sailing towards Buenos Aires. She was repaired in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, as no suitable dry-docks were available closer. Paid off on 15 October 1958. She arrived at Osaka, Japan for breaking up on 19 November 1960. This felt pennant is 19" in length.
